Ingredients You’ll Need

Getting started on this scrumptious pasta is easier than you might think. Each ingredient has a special role—from the hearty ground beef adding boldness, to the creamy cheeses that bring everything together into a velvety dream of taste and texture.

  • 8 oz penne pasta: Holds sauce beautifully with its ridged shape for maximum flavor absorption.
  • 1 lb ground beef: The star protein that brings juicy, meaty richness to the dish.
  • 1 cup heavy cream: Creates the creamy Alfredo sauce base, making each bite luxuriously smooth.
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ese: Adds sharp, melty cheesiness reminiscent of a classic cheeseburger.
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ese: Brings a nutty depth and extra savory note to the sauce.
  • 1/2 cup diced tomatoes: Delivers a touch of fresh sweetness and vibrant color contrast.
  • 1/4 cup diced onions: Provides aromatic sweetness that enhances the overall flavor profile.
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ced: Infuses the dish with a subtle, savory punch that lingers delightfully.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Essential seasoning that balances and elevates every mouthful.

How to Make Cheeseburger Alfredo Pasta: 5 Steps to Comfort Food Bliss Recipe

Step 1: Cook the Pasta Perfectly

Start by boiling your penne pasta according to the package instructions until it’s al dente—tender but still firm to the bite. Once cooked, drain it well and set aside. This simple step ensures the pasta will hold up against the creamy sauce without becoming mushy.

Step 2: Brown the Ground Beef

In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ef, breaking it apart as it browns. This step is crucial for developing that savory, meaty flavor reminiscent of a juicy cheeseburger. When the beef is cooked through, drain any excess fat to keep the dish from getting greasy.

Step 3: Sauté Onions and Garlic

Next, add the diced onions and minced garlic to the skillet with your browned beef. Cook until the onions turn translucent and fragrant—this layer of aromatics brings sweetness and that irresistible home-cooked aroma.

Step 4: Create the Creamy Cheese Sauce

Pour in the heavy cream and sprinkle in both the shredded cheddar and grated Parmesan cheeses. Stir continuously as the cheeses melt into the cream, transforming it into a rich, velvety sauce. The blend of cheddar and Parmesan offers a delightful balance of sharpness and nuttiness that hugs every pasta piece.

Step 5: Combine and Season

Finally, toss the cooked pasta and diced tomatoes into the skillet, mixing everything until the pasta is fully coated in the sauce and the tomatoes are dispersed throughout. Season with salt and pepper to your liking, then serve immediately for the ultimate comfort experience.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Place any leftover Cheeseburger Alfredo Pasta in an airtight container and store it in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h and tasty for up to three days, making it perfect for next-day lunches or quick dinners.

Freezing

You can freeze this dish, but do so before adding the cream sauce, if possible, to maintain the best texture. Freeze the cooked pasta and beef mixture in a sealed container for up to two months, then add the sauce fresh when reheating.

Reheating

Reheat leftovers gently on the stovetop over low heat or in the microwave, adding a splash of milk or cream to revive the sauce’s creaminess and prevent it from drying out.

FAQs

Can I use a different type of pasta?

Absolutely! While penne works wonderfully for holding the sauce, feel free to use fusilli, rigatoni, or even elbow macaroni—the key is picking pasta shapes that catch the creamy sauce.

Is there a vegetarian version of the Cheeseburger Alfredo Pasta: 5 Steps to Comfort Food Bliss Recipe?

Yes! Swap out the ground beef for plant-based crumbles or sautéed mushrooms to maintain texture and flavor while keeping it vegetarian-friendly.

Can I make this dish dairy-free?

You can try substituting heavy cream with coconut cream and use dairy-free cheese alternatives. However, the taste and texture will differ from the classic comfort this recipe provides.

How spicy is this dish?

By default, it’s mild and rich, focusing on creamy cheeseburger flavors. You can always spice it up with crushed red pepper or hot sauce to suit your palate.

Can I prepare this recipe ahead of time?

Yes! You can cook the beef and pasta in advance, then combine and heat the sauce just before serving to keep the creamy texture fresh and delicious.

Ingredients

Scale

Pasta

  • 8 oz penne pasta

Meat

  • 1 lb ground beef

Sauce

  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up diced onions
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

Other

  • 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
  • Salt and pepper to taste


Instructions

  1. Cook pasta: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the penne pasta and cook according to the package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  2. Brown ground beef: In a large skillet over medium heat, add the ground beef. Cook, stirring occasionally, until browned and fully cooked through. Drain any excess fat from the skillet.
  3. Sauté aromatics: Add the diced onions and minced garlic to the skillet with the beef. Cook for about 3-4 minutes, until the onions become translucent and fragrant.
  4. Make cheese sauce: Pour in the heavy cream, then add the shredded cheddar cheese and grated Parmesan. Stir continuously over low to medium heat until the cheese melts completely and the sauce becomes smooth and creamy.
  5. Combine pasta and tomatoes: Add the cooked penne pasta and diced tomatoes to the skillet. Stir well to coat the pasta evenly with the cheesy beef sauce.
  6. Season and serve: Taste the dish and season with salt and pepper as needed. Serve the Cheeseburger Alfredo Pasta hot for a delicious and hearty meal.

Notes

  • Use freshly grated Parmesan for best melting and flavor.
  • Drain the ground beef well to avoid a greasy sauce.
  • If you prefer a thinner sauce, add a splash of milk or reserved pasta water.
  • Feel free to add chopped fresh basil or parsley for garnish.
  • This dish pairs well with a green salad or steamed vegetables.
